WWE Network - Royal Rumble and FastLane PPVs free when you sign up for the free month on the 21st January. Royal Rumble is on Sunday 24th at Midnight (Monday morning), FastLane is on Sunday 21st February. Also enjoy NxT, wwe programming and past ppv matches throughout wwf/e history.
Royal Rumble 2016, the winner this year not only gets into the main match at Wrestlemania, they also win the WWE World Heavyweight Championship! The decision was made by the Chairman Vincent Kennedy McMahon at Monday Night Raw on the 4th January, peeved at the actions of the current two time WHC Roman Reigns.
